Overview
SS220BF is a high-performance Schottky Diode manufactured by LGE, a reputable name in semiconductor solutions. This component falls under the broader category of Semiconductors, specifically within Schottky barrier rectifiers. Schottky diodes are a type of semiconductor diode characterized by a low forward voltage drop and a very fast switching action. Unlike conventional PN junction diodes, a Schottky diode uses a metal-semiconductor junction, which results in a lower voltage drop across the diode when current flows through it, making them highly efficient, especially in power conversion applications. The SS220BF is designed to offer excellent rectification capabilities with minimal power loss, making it suitable for a wide range of electronic circuits requiring efficient power management.Key Specifications
The SS220BF boasts several critical specifications that define its performance and suitability for various applications:
- VFM V (Forward Voltage Maximum): 0.95V – This attribute indicates the maximum voltage drop across the diode when it is conducting current in the forward direction. A lower forward voltage drop signifies less power dissipation and higher efficiency, which is crucial in power supply and converter designs to minimize heat generation and improve overall system performance. At 0.95V, the SS220BF offers a competitive forward voltage, contributing to its efficiency.
- IFSM A (Forward Surge Current Maximum): 50A – This specifies the maximum non-repetitive surge current that the diode can withstand for a very short duration, typically during power-up or transient events. A high IFSM rating, such as 50A for the SS220BF, indicates robust design and the ability to handle momentary overloads without damage, enhancing the reliability and longevity of the device in demanding applications.
- I(AV) A (Average Forward Current): 2A – This represents the maximum average current that the diode can continuously conduct in the forward direction without exceeding its thermal limits. An I(AV) of 2A makes the SS220BF suitable for medium-power rectification tasks, such as in switch-mode power supplies, DC-DC converters, and freewheeling applications where a steady current flow is required.
- I(AV) A #2 (Average Forward Current, secondary listing): 2A – This is a reiteration of the average forward current, emphasizing its continuous current handling capability under specified conditions. It reinforces the diode’s capacity for sustained operation at 2 amperes.
- Package / Case: SMBF – The SMBF (Small Outline DO-214AA Flat Lead) package is a surface-mount device (SMD) package. It is known for its compact size, low profile, and excellent thermal characteristics, making it ideal for space-constrained applications. The flat lead design facilitates better heat dissipation and simplifies automated assembly processes, contributing to lower manufacturing costs and increased reliability in modern electronic designs.
- VRRM (I=IRM) V (Peak Repetitive Reverse Voltage): 220V – This is the maximum reverse voltage that the diode can repeatedly withstand without breaking down. A VRRM of 220V signifies that the SS220BF can be safely used in circuits with relatively high reverse voltage requirements, providing a good margin of safety and preventing reverse breakdown, which could damage the component.
- IRM TA=25℃ mA (Reverse Current Maximum at 25°C): 0.1mA – This parameter indicates the maximum current that flows through the diode when it is reverse-biased at 25°C. A low reverse current, such as 0.1mA, is desirable as it signifies minimal power loss in the reverse-biased state, contributing to the overall efficiency of the circuit and reducing quiescent power consumption.
- Device / IC Type: Schottky Diode – This explicitly identifies the component as a Schottky Diode, highlighting its fundamental operational principle and distinguishing features, such as fast switching speed and low forward voltage drop, compared to other diode types.
Features and Benefits
- High Efficiency: The low forward voltage drop of 0.95V minimizes power losses, making the SS220BF highly efficient in rectification and power conversion applications, leading to cooler operation and extended battery life in portable devices.
- Fast Switching Speed: As a Schottky diode, it offers extremely fast switching characteristics, which is critical for high-frequency applications like switch-mode power supplies (SMPS) and DC-DC converters, improving overall circuit performance.
- Robust Surge Capability: With an IFSM of 50A, the SS220BF can withstand significant non-repetitive surge currents, providing enhanced reliability and protection against transient events, thus increasing the lifespan of the end product.
- Compact SMBF Package: The SMBF surface-mount package ensures a small footprint, enabling higher component density on PCBs and facilitating automated assembly, which is beneficial for miniaturized and cost-effective electronic designs.
- High Reverse Voltage Capability: A 220V VRRM rating allows for use in applications requiring robust reverse voltage protection, ensuring stable and reliable operation even in environments with voltage fluctuations.
Typical Applications
- Switch-Mode Power Supplies (SMPS): The fast switching speed and low forward voltage drop of the SS220BF make it an excellent choice for output rectification in SMPS, where efficiency and speed are paramount for stable power delivery.
- DC-DC Converters: It is widely used in various DC-DC converter topologies, including buck, boost, and buck-boost converters, to efficiently convert and regulate DC voltage levels in a wide array of electronic devices.
- Freewheeling Diodes: In inductive load applications such as motor drives and relay circuits, the SS220BF serves as a freewheeling diode, protecting switching transistors from voltage spikes generated by collapsing magnetic fields and improving overall circuit reliability.
- Polarity Protection: Due to its low forward voltage drop, it is ideal for polarity protection circuits in battery-powered devices, minimizing power loss while safeguarding against incorrect battery insertion.
- Voltage Clamping: The SS220BF can be employed in voltage clamping circuits to protect sensitive components from overvoltage conditions, diverting excess voltage away from critical parts of a circuit.
